Ingredients
– 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s
– 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
– 2 (8-oz) packages of cream cheese, softened
– 1 cup granulated sugar
–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
– 3 large eggs
– ¼ cup sour cream
– ½ cup brown sugar
– 1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
– 1 cup powdered sugar (for glaze)
– 2-3 tablespoons milk (for glaze)
Equipment Needed
– 9-inch springform pan
– Mixing bowls
– Hand mixer or stand mixer
– Rubber spatula
– Measuring cups and spoons
– Whisk
– Oven
Step-by-Step Instructions
To start, preheat your oven to 325°F (160°C), and grease your springform pan with a little cooking spray or butter to prevent sticking. In a medium bowl, mix the graham cracker crumbs and melted butter until it resembles wet sand. Press this mixture firmly into the bottom of the pan to form a crust.
